Lewis back on track at Jerez

DateFeb 12 2009
Read01:30

World champion Lewis Hamilton returned to the cockpit today, testing his new McLaren MP4-24 at the Jerez circuit in southern Spain. The Stevenage-born driver looked fit and refreshed as he went from his motorhome to the pits, even posing for pictures with fans.

Hamilton s new car appeared to be sporting a 2008-spec rear-wing arrangement, however. Lewis managed a best lap of 1.20.737 for the first stint of 25 laps in the car, which has already been shaken down by team test driver Pedro de la Rosa and race driver Heikki Kovalainen,

Hamilton will be in Jerez all day today and tomorrow, preparing for the defence of his crown in the upcoming season.
